<u>Given</u>:

The given function f(x)=19,000 \cdot 0.96 ^x which models the value of Mark’s car, where x represents the number of years since he purchased the car.

We need to determine the approximate value of Mark's car after 7 years.

<u>Value of the car:</u>

The value of the car after 7 years can be determined by substituting x = 7 in the function f(x)=19,000 \cdot 0.96 ^x, we get;

f(7)=19,000 \cdot 0.96 ^7

f(7)=19,000 \cdot 0.7514474781

f(7)=14277.502

Rounding off to the nearest dollar, we get;

f(7)=14278

Thus, the approximate value of Mark's car after 7 years is $14278.
